// Validate returns an error if the log config specified are less than the
// minimum allowed. Note that because we have a non-zero default MaxFiles and
// MaxFileSizeMB, we can't validate that they're unset if Disabled=true
func (l *LogConfig) Validate() error {
func (l *LogConfig) Validate(disk *EphemeralDisk) error {
var mErr multierror.Error
if l.MaxFiles < 1 {
mErr.Errors = append(mErr.Errors, fmt.Errorf("minimum number of files is 1; got %d", l.MaxFiles))
}
if l.MaxFileSizeMB < 1 {
mErr.Errors = append(mErr.Errors, fmt.Errorf("minimum file size is 1MB; got %d", l.MaxFileSizeMB))
}
if disk != nil {
logUsage := (l.MaxFiles * l.MaxFileSizeMB)
if disk.SizeMB <= logUsage {
mErr.Errors = append(mErr.Errors,
fmt.Errorf("log storage (%d MB) must be less than requested disk capacity (%d MB)",
logUsage, disk.SizeMB))
}
}
return mErr.ErrorOrNil()
}
